About the MRT Putrajaya Line

The MRT Putrajaya Line covers approximately 57.7 kilometres and has 36 operational stations running from Kwasa Damansara through northern Kuala Lumpur, KLCC, TRX, Kuchai Lama, Seri Kembangan, Cyberjaya and Putrajaya.

It also includes 10 interchange or connecting stations, allowing commuters to transfer to the Kajang MRT Line, Kelana Jaya LRT Line, Ampang and Sri Petaling LRT lines, KTM services and KLIA Transit.

You can view the complete route on the official MRT Corp Putrajaya Line page.

Properties Near Kwasa Damansara MRT Interchange

Kwasa Damansara MRT is especially important because it connects the Putrajaya Line with the Kajang Line.

Residents can travel towards TRX and KLCC using the Putrajaya Line or towards Kota Damansara, Mutiara Damansara, Bandar Utama and central Kuala Lumpur through the Kajang Line.

The surrounding Kwasa Damansara township is also being developed with residential neighbourhoods, parks, future commercial districts and pedestrian infrastructure.

Properties Near Kwasa Sentral MRT

Kwasa Sentral is on the MRT Kajang Line rather than the Putrajaya Line.

However, it is only one station from Kwasa Damansara MRT, where passengers can interchange with the Putrajaya Line.

This makes projects around Kwasa Sentral relevant to buyers who want access to both MRT corridors.

Properties Near Ampang Park MRT

Ampang Park is one of the most strategically important city-centre stations because it connects the MRT Putrajaya Line with the LRT Kelana Jaya Line.

The surrounding area includes KLCC, Jalan Ampang, international embassies, corporate offices, hotels, hospitals, shopping centres and established expatriate neighbourhoods.

Properties Near TRX MRT Interchange

TRX is one of the most important MRT stations in Kuala Lumpur because it connects the Putrajaya Line with the Kajang Line.

It also serves Tun Razak Exchange, Malaysia’s international financial district, where major offices, hotels, retail, dining and public spaces are being developed.

For investors, the primary attraction is the potential tenant population working within and around the financial district.

Bukit Bintang Properties One Stop From TRX

Bukit Bintang MRT is on the Kajang Line rather than the Putrajaya Line.

However, it is only one station from TRX MRT Interchange. Residents can travel to TRX and transfer directly to the Putrajaya Line.

Bukit Bintang also offers something different from TRX and KLCC: an established shopping, hotel, dining and entertainment ecosystem that already attracts tourists, expatriates and international visitors.

Does Being Near MRT Guarantee a Good Investment?

No.

MRT accessibility can support rental demand and make daily life more convenient, but it does not automatically make every nearby property a good investment.

Buyers should also compare:

  • Purchase price and price per square foot
  • Actual walking route to the station
  • Covered versus uncovered access
  • Unit size and layout efficiency
  • Total number of competing units
  • Maintenance and management costs
  • Target tenant profile
  • Current and future rental supply
  • Furnishing and renovation costs
  • Loan commitment and holding ability
  • Completion timeline
  • Alternative resale properties nearby

A property 600 metres from an MRT station with a practical covered route may be more convenient than a project advertised as 300 metres away but separated by busy roads or an unsuitable pedestrian path.

The actual experience matters more than the marketing distance.


Frequently Asked Questions

Is Kwasa Sentral on the MRT Putrajaya Line?

No. Kwasa Sentral is on the MRT Kajang Line.

However, it is only one station from Kwasa Damansara MRT, where passengers can interchange with the Putrajaya Line.

This makes projects such as D’Evia and Daya Residence relevant to buyers who want convenient access to both lines.

Is Bukit Bintang MRT on the Putrajaya Line?

No. Bukit Bintang MRT is on the Kajang Line.

It is one station from TRX MRT Interchange, which connects the Kajang and Putrajaya lines.
